ISO 9001 (quality management)
The worlds most recognised quality management system standard
ISO9001 has been adopted by over 1 million organisations worldwide. It is used by businesses to monitor, manage, and improve the quality of their products and services.
What is ISO 9001?
ISO 9001, published by International Organisation for Standardisation, is the International governing Standard for Quality Management Systems and considered to be the most used management tools across the world.
Each organisation adopts this framework to help ensure consistent quality in the provision of goods and/or services required to meet the needs of customers and other stakeholders.

ISO 27001 (information security management)
Protecting your corporate information and data and manage threats
ISO 27001 certification demonstrates that each business has systems in place to protect corporate information and data, whether this is online or offline.
The way in which you manage and use corporate information can mean the difference between the success and failure for your business.
What is ISO 27001?
The ISO 27001 standard provides the framework for an effective Information Security Management System (ISMS). It is internationally recognised and sets out the policies and procedures needed to protect your organisation and includes all the risk controls (legal, physical, and technical) necessary for robust IT security management.
This certification demonstrates companies are showing a commitment to ensuring that adequate security controls are in place to protect information and data from being accessed, corrupted, lost or stolen.
ADISA Fully accredited Business
Incorporated in 2010, ADISA have become the standard that you should look to adhere to.
An independent body that audits the majority of our partners. They promote the best practice for data sanitisation and data protection working with organisations across the globe.
ADISA are ICO governed, UKAS accredited and NCSC approved.

Cyber essentials
Have peace of mind knowing that your data-bearing assets are thoroughly protected against any cyber attacks.
What is cyber essentials?
Cyber essentials has been described by the NCSC as an effective, government backed scheme that ensures companies have adhered to certain practices to prevent cyber-attacks.
Certification gives you assurances that our partners are continuously working to secure their IT against cyber-attacks.
